Amanda Parris Hosts an Insider’s Study of Modern Blackness in For the Culture.

in Entertainment, What She Said on 01/26/24

CBC stalwart Amanda Parris travelled and listened to collect intel on the ways Blackness has changed as a lived concept. Larry Wilmore, Bolu Babalola, Gina Yashere, and Mwazulu Diyabanza join Parris in provocative discussions of topics including reparations for slavery, the crisis in Black maternal care, the meaning of Black hair, and what Parris calls “the diaspora wars”. As producer and host, Parris puts her unique thumbprint on these important conversations.

For the Culture Premieres Jan. 30 on CBC and CBC Gem
